/kernel/linux/linux-5.10/lib/ |
H A D | plist.c | 59 plist_check_list(&plist_first(head)->prio_list); in plist_check_head() 80 WARN_ON(!list_empty(&node->prio_list)); in plist_add() 94 iter = list_entry(iter->prio_list.next, in plist_add() 95 struct plist_node, prio_list); in plist_add() 99 list_add_tail(&node->prio_list, &iter->prio_list); in plist_add() 116 if (!list_empty(&node->prio_list)) { in plist_del() 123 /* add the next plist_node into prio_list */ in plist_del() 124 if (list_empty(&next->prio_list)) in plist_del() 125 list_add(&next->prio_list, in plist_del() [all...] |
H A D | parman.c | 56 struct list_head prio_list; member 118 list_for_each_entry_from_reverse(prio, &parman->prio_list, list) { in parman_lsort_new_index_find() 197 list_for_each_entry_reverse(prio2, &parman->prio_list, list) { in parman_lsort_item_add() 213 list_for_each_entry_continue(prio, &parman->prio_list, list) in parman_lsort_item_remove() 275 INIT_LIST_HEAD(&parman->prio_list); in parman_create() 292 WARN_ON(!list_empty(&parman->prio_list)); in parman_destroy() 318 list_for_each(pos, &parman->prio_list) { in parman_prio_init()
|
/kernel/linux/linux-6.6/lib/ |
H A D | plist.c | 59 plist_check_list(&plist_first(head)->prio_list); in plist_check_head() 80 WARN_ON(!list_empty(&node->prio_list)); in plist_add() 94 iter = list_entry(iter->prio_list.next, in plist_add() 95 struct plist_node, prio_list); in plist_add() 99 list_add_tail(&node->prio_list, &iter->prio_list); in plist_add() 116 if (!list_empty(&node->prio_list)) { in plist_del() 123 /* add the next plist_node into prio_list */ in plist_del() 124 if (list_empty(&next->prio_list)) in plist_del() 125 list_add(&next->prio_list, in plist_del() [all...] |
H A D | parman.c | 56 struct list_head prio_list; member 117 list_for_each_entry_from_reverse(prio, &parman->prio_list, list) { in parman_lsort_new_index_find() 196 list_for_each_entry_reverse(prio2, &parman->prio_list, list) { in parman_lsort_item_add() 212 list_for_each_entry_continue(prio, &parman->prio_list, list) in parman_lsort_item_remove() 274 INIT_LIST_HEAD(&parman->prio_list); in parman_create() 291 WARN_ON(!list_empty(&parman->prio_list)); in parman_destroy() 317 list_for_each(pos, &parman->prio_list) { in parman_prio_init()
|
/kernel/linux/linux-5.10/net/sctp/ |
H A D | stream_sched_prio.c | 67 list_for_each_entry(p, &stream->prio_list, prio_sched) { in sctp_sched_prio_get_head() 97 pos = p->next->prio_list.next; in sctp_sched_prio_next_stream() 100 p->next = list_entry(pos, struct sctp_stream_out_ext, prio_list); in sctp_sched_prio_next_stream() 107 if (!list_empty(&soute->prio_list)) { in sctp_sched_prio_unsched() 117 list_del_init(&soute->prio_list); in sctp_sched_prio_unsched() 138 if (!list_empty(&soute->prio_list)) in sctp_sched_prio_sched() 146 list_add(&soute->prio_list, prio_head->next->prio_list.prev); in sctp_sched_prio_sched() 150 list_add(&soute->prio_list, &prio_head->active); in sctp_sched_prio_sched() 153 list_for_each_entry(prio, &stream->prio_list, prio_sche in sctp_sched_prio_sched() [all...] |
/kernel/linux/linux-6.6/net/sctp/ |
H A D | stream_sched_prio.c | 67 list_for_each_entry(p, &stream->prio_list, prio_sched) { in sctp_sched_prio_get_head() 97 pos = p->next->prio_list.next; in sctp_sched_prio_next_stream() 100 p->next = list_entry(pos, struct sctp_stream_out_ext, prio_list); in sctp_sched_prio_next_stream() 107 if (!list_empty(&soute->prio_list)) { in sctp_sched_prio_unsched() 117 list_del_init(&soute->prio_list); in sctp_sched_prio_unsched() 138 if (!list_empty(&soute->prio_list)) in sctp_sched_prio_sched() 146 list_add(&soute->prio_list, prio_head->next->prio_list.prev); in sctp_sched_prio_sched() 150 list_add(&soute->prio_list, &prio_head->active); in sctp_sched_prio_sched() 153 list_for_each_entry(prio, &stream->prio_list, prio_sche in sctp_sched_prio_sched() [all...] |
/kernel/linux/linux-5.10/drivers/bus/ |
H A D | da8xx-mstpri.c | 207 const struct da8xx_mstpri_board_priorities *prio_list; in da8xx_mstpri_probe() local 223 prio_list = da8xx_mstpri_get_board_prio(); in da8xx_mstpri_probe() 224 if (!prio_list) { in da8xx_mstpri_probe() 229 for (i = 0; i < prio_list->numprio; i++) { in da8xx_mstpri_probe() 230 prio = &prio_list->priorities[i]; in da8xx_mstpri_probe()
|
/kernel/linux/linux-6.6/drivers/bus/ |
H A D | da8xx-mstpri.c | 207 const struct da8xx_mstpri_board_priorities *prio_list; in da8xx_mstpri_probe() local 223 prio_list = da8xx_mstpri_get_board_prio(); in da8xx_mstpri_probe() 224 if (!prio_list) { in da8xx_mstpri_probe() 229 for (i = 0; i < prio_list->numprio; i++) { in da8xx_mstpri_probe() 230 prio = &prio_list->priorities[i]; in da8xx_mstpri_probe()
|
/kernel/linux/linux-5.10/include/linux/ |
H A D | plist.h | 27 * - The tier 1 list is the prio_list, different priority nodes. 33 * pl:prio_list (only for plist_node) 45 * The nodes on the prio_list list are sorted by priority to simplify 53 * Addition means: look for the prio_list node in the prio_list 55 * entry of the next prio_list node. If it is the first node of 56 * that priority, add it to the prio_list in the right position and 60 * the prio_list if the node_list list_head is non empty. In case 61 * of removal from the prio_list it must be checked whether other 64 * replace the removed entry on the prio_list 85 struct list_head prio_list; global() member [all...] |
/kernel/linux/linux-6.6/include/linux/ |
H A D | plist.h | 27 * - The tier 1 list is the prio_list, different priority nodes. 33 * pl:prio_list (only for plist_node) 45 * The nodes on the prio_list list are sorted by priority to simplify 53 * Addition means: look for the prio_list node in the prio_list 55 * entry of the next prio_list node. If it is the first node of 56 * that priority, add it to the prio_list in the right position and 60 * the prio_list if the node_list list_head is non empty. In case 61 * of removal from the prio_list it must be checked whether other 64 * replace the removed entry on the prio_list 88 struct list_head prio_list; global() member [all...] |
/kernel/linux/linux-5.10/drivers/net/ethernet/mellanox/mlx4/ |
H A D | alloc.c | 214 struct list_head prio_list; member 269 list_for_each_entry(it, &zone_alloc->prios, prio_list) in mlx4_zone_add_one() 273 if (&it->prio_list == &zone_alloc->prios || it->priority > priority) in mlx4_zone_add_one() 274 list_add_tail(&zone->prio_list, &it->prio_list); in mlx4_zone_add_one() 289 if (!list_empty(&entry->prio_list)) { in __mlx4_zone_remove_one_entry() 297 list_add_tail(&next->prio_list, &entry->prio_list); in __mlx4_zone_remove_one_entry() 300 list_del(&entry->prio_list); in __mlx4_zone_remove_one_entry() 309 list_for_each_entry(it, &zone_alloc->prios, prio_list) { in __mlx4_zone_remove_one_entry() [all...] |
/kernel/linux/linux-6.6/drivers/net/ethernet/mellanox/mlx4/ |
H A D | alloc.c | 214 struct list_head prio_list; member 269 list_for_each_entry(it, &zone_alloc->prios, prio_list) in mlx4_zone_add_one() 273 if (&it->prio_list == &zone_alloc->prios || it->priority > priority) in mlx4_zone_add_one() 274 list_add_tail(&zone->prio_list, &it->prio_list); in mlx4_zone_add_one() 289 if (!list_empty(&entry->prio_list)) { in __mlx4_zone_remove_one_entry() 297 list_add_tail(&next->prio_list, &entry->prio_list); in __mlx4_zone_remove_one_entry() 300 list_del(&entry->prio_list); in __mlx4_zone_remove_one_entry() 309 list_for_each_entry(it, &zone_alloc->prios, prio_list) { in __mlx4_zone_remove_one_entry() [all...] |
/kernel/linux/linux-5.10/include/net/sctp/ |
H A D | structs.h | 1407 struct list_head prio_list; member 1451 struct list_head prio_list; member
|
/kernel/linux/linux-6.6/include/net/sctp/ |
H A D | structs.h | 1423 struct list_head prio_list; member 1472 struct list_head prio_list; member
|